The Eagles have won the Lombardi and every Philly fan must be waiting for the Super Bowl parade. The Eagles’ Super Bowl parade is gonna be on February 14 and it will start at 11 am. Fans will gather on the Philly streets to celebrate the insane SB win over the Chiefs. What a crazy SB game that was! The Philadelphia Eagles made everything look easy for the 40-22 Super Bowl LIX win. The franchise quarterback has become the first quarterback in NFL history to win a Super Bowl rematch. Jalen Hurts and Co. has made Patrick Mahomes apologize to Kansas City fans. And who can deny the fact that HC Nick Sirianni‘s team has made Philly proud? The Philly fans were crying their eyes out after the win out of happiness. They were booing and trolling the opponents and also… uprooting traffic lights in Philadelphia. 

You must have seen how the Eagles players touched the Lombardi after it was awarded. It was a childlike moment for every team member just to feel what success looks like. The Philadelphia Eagles have won the rematch of Super Bowl LVII in 2023, where they had lost 35-38 to the Chiefs. It was so heartbreaking that Jalen Hurts avoided the question regarding it before the New Orleans matchup. But all things said and done… The Eagles have won their second Super Bowl. A chill on the Philadelphia Eagles Super Bowl parade

Fans are excited about the Eagles’ Super Bowl parade this Friday, but here’s the problem: A ‘snow-laden update’ has hit the city. The National Weather Service reported Tuesday that the snowstorm will affect southern Delaware, the southernmost Jersey Shore communities, and other parts of the city. According to NBC Philadelphia, snow will begin late Tuesday afternoon and continue overnight into Wednesday morning. They also expect heavy snowfall.

via Imago

But it has been forecast for the upcoming two days only, starting from Tuesday. And it is expected that the sky will be sunny and the temperature will be a little bit higher on Friday. So, the cold wind would be there but the sky would be sunny on the Super Bowl parade day. Apart from the weather forecast, the city has advised motorists and travelers to avoid the Super Bowl parade area. In addition to this, schools will also be closed.

All Philadelphia public schools closed ahead of Super Bowl parade by the Philadelphia Eagles 

Several NFL reporters have revealed that the city of Philadelphia has decided to close all public schools ahead of Friday’s Super Bowl parade. The South Jersey School District was the first to announce the closure. The school’s office applauded the Eagles’ Super Bowl parade, saying, “We recognize the significance of this historic event and understand that many in our community will want to take part in the celebrations. Enjoy the festivities, stay safe, and Fly, Eagles!”

The closure is intended to allow children to witness rare moments. According to reports, the city expects over one million fans to attend the Super Bowl parade. The Philadelphia mayor, Cherelle Parker, will join the parade with city residents, children, and all football fans.
